There are other types of non-viral malware, too. But like a virus, adware can infect your device without you knowing how it got on there, and it can disrupt the way your computer operates.Īdware and viruses are different types of malware. Adware doesn’t self-replicate on its own like viruses, which create copies of themselves to spread and corrupt new hosts. Is adware the same as a virus?Īdware and viruses are both types of malware, but they’re not the same. Some types of adware can also compromise your device’s security and allow other forms of malware to slip through. And, once the adware developer has your browser history, they can sell that data to third parties. Adware can track your online activity to display targeted ads. While it bombards your computer or browser and makes for an extremely irritating online experience, adware can be even more damaging to your data privacy. Adware’s purpose is to make money for developers or advertisers.
